The Russian Ministry of Defense has information about the creation of a secret Strategy in the United States to counter weapons of mass destruction.

The open (unclassified) part of the document was published on September 27, 2023. It specifies the provisions of the National Defense Strategy in the field of responding to threats to national security associated with the use of WMD.

According to the Pentagon, the Russian Federation, China, Iran and the DPRK consider weapons of mass destruction as a means of limiting the ability of the United States to achieve strategic goals during wars and military conflicts.

In accordance with the Strategy, Russia is described as a source of "acute threat" to American security in the medium and long term.

The People's Republic of China is defined as a "growing challenge". It is emphasized that Beijing has recently made significant progress in the modernization of strategic nuclear forces. The DPRK and Iran are identified as permanent threats.

According to the developers, the priority areas of activity of the US Department of Defense are:

- ensuring the protection of the national territory from external aggression with the use of WMD;

- unconditional deterrence of potential opponents from using it against the United States and its allies;

- creation of consolidated units capable of effectively conducting combat operations and winning in conditions of HCB infection.

At the same time, the Strategy sets the task of coordinating and increasing efforts to create means of protection against new chemical and biological threats.

Let me remind you that the Russian Federation has proposed a number of practical initiatives to strengthen the biological weapons non-proliferation regime and improve confidence-building measures under the Convention.

First of all, it is the resumption of negotiations on the development of a legally binding protocol to the BTWC with an effective verification mechanism that would include lists of pathogenic microorganisms, toxins, specialized equipment, and would be comprehensive.

The second is to expand the format of confidence–building measures by providing information on research and development in the field of biological protection carried out outside the national territory.

The third is the creation of a Scientific Advisory Committee to evaluate achievements in the fields of science and technology, which would have a wide geographical representation and equal rights of participants.

The fourth is the use of mobile biomedical detachments within the framework of the BTWC.

The practical implementation of our proposals will contribute to increasing the transparency of national biological programs and compliance with the requirements of the Convention by all participating States, including the United States, without exception.
